摘要
Objective: Interpersonal spin refers to within-person variability in social behavior. Pen-and-paper Event-Contingent Recording (ECR) has typically been used to measure spin, establish its reliability, and explore its relation with personality characteristics and variability in situational features. The present study aims to replicate these studies using mobile application-based ECR.Method: 267 students participated in a 20-day ECR procedure, reporting on social interactions via mobile application. Five-factor traits were measured pre-ECR using self-report. Spin scores and situational features were assessed across interpersonal interactions.Results: The reliability of spin scores was substantial but was lower than in previous studies. We partially confirmed previous findings, demonstrating that spin is predicted by Neuroticism, although the effect was smaller than in previous studies, and not meaningfully predicted by variability in external situational features.Conclusions: The present study provides some support for an application-based ECR procedure to collect data about within-person variability in social behavior. Practical and procedural advantages and limitations of this method are discussed. Differences in reliability and effect sizes between the present study and previous studies raise important considerations for future research.
